In short
The Axis1 Tour (2021) is a mallet putter built for stability and easier alignment. It has mid toe hang.
Axis1 built its whole reputation on one idea, torque. Or rather, getting rid of it. The company's patented head shape pushes weight into a heel counterbalance that sits ahead of the face, and the goal is a putter that doesn't want to twist open or snap shut during the stroke. The 2021 Tour is the flagship expression of that idea, a mallet that looks like almost nothing else in the putter corral.
Here's the thing that surprises people who only know the marketing. This version of the Tour hangs with mid toe hang, not the face-balanced setup you'd assume from a mallet. That makes it a fit for players with a slight to moderate arc in their stroke, which describes most golfers, not the straight-back-straight-through minority.
The other notable choice is what's missing. There's no alignment aid on this head. No sightline, no dots, no flange channel. You aim it with the face and the topline, the way blade players have always done it. That's a deliberate call, and it tells you who Axis1 thinks should be putting with this thing.
The head is a compact mallet with the signature Axis1 heel counterweight, the piece of mass that juts forward of the face on the heel side. It looks strange at address the first few times, then you stop noticing it. That weight placement is the engineering story here, moving the center of gravity onto the sweet spot so the face resists twisting on off-center hits and through impact. The crown is kept clean and uncluttered, which pairs naturally with the no-alignment-aid decision. Combined with the mid toe hang, you get an odd but coherent package, mallet stability in the head with the release characteristics and clean look of a blade. Players who arc the putter but want more forgiveness than an Anser-style head provides are the intended audience, and the design doesn't stray from that brief.

| Brand | Axis1 |
| Model | Tour |
| Year | 2021 |
| Type | Mallet |
| Toe hang | Mid toe hang |
| Alignment aid | No |
